The promoting effect of byproducts from <it>Irpex lacteus </it>on subsequent enzymatic hydrolysis of bio-pretreated cornstalks
<p>Abstract</p> <p>Background</p> <p><it>Irpex lacteus</it>, a versatile lignin-degrading fungus with various extracellular enzymes, has been widely used for biological pretreatment. However, most studies have focused on the change of substrate structure aft...
